Handover — Darra to Milt. Contractor from Quellworks starts Monday, fit-out on level 3 at the Brindlemoor site. Walk him through fire exits first, then the tool cage. He has no fob yet, so escort until Wednesday. For the service corridor, use the temporary pass below.

staff pass of kawip-hawef = bdg-QLP-2

## Deployment notes — DNS weirdness

Heads up for reviewers: the Copperlane resolver occasionally times out inside the Thornquist cluster, so the Veldmark service ships with a local caching stub and a short negative-cache TTL. It's not elegant, but it stopped the flaky startup failures. We deliberately avoid hardcoding upstream addresses; everything comes from the environment at deploy time. The resolver-related settings the service reads on boot are shown here.

service settings:
novath:
  pin: 1396
  tenant: pelys
  seal: seal_ccc035e1
  metrics_host: metrics.novath.qorvelworks.test
  standby_team: fraeth
  escalation: drueth-zorok
  nonce: 61d508

### Runbook: BounceBroom — Account Recovery

If the BounceBroom email bounce processor loses access to its service account, do not create a new one. First, pause the intake queue so bounces buffer safely. Then open the recovery console and select the BounceBroom principal. Verification requires approval from the on-call lead. Once approved, the console prompts for the stored recovery credentials; enter the passphrase that appears directly below this paragraph.

recovery phrase for fahof-kahap: holion-gormir-jorix-istix-briwyn-sorael